Prime Video announced today the global premiere date for Ballard, the new Bosch spin-off crime drama series starring Maggie Q.

Ballard is the latest series in the “Bosch” universe, following the original Bosch and the spin-off Bosch: Legacy.
Based on the “Renée Ballard” crime novels by best-selling author Michael Connelly, Ballard stars Maggie Q (Bosch: Legacy, Designated Survivor, Pivoting) as Detective Renée Ballard, who leads the LAPD’s new and underfunded cold case division, tackling the city’s most challenging long-forgotten crimes with empathy and relentless determination.
As Ballard peels back layers of crimes spanning decades, including a serial killer’s string of murders and a murdered John Doe, she soon uncovers a dangerous conspiracy within the LAPD. With the help of her volunteer team and retired detective Harry Bosch (Titus Welliver), Ballard navigates personal trauma, professional challenges, and life-threatening dangers to expose the truth.
Ballard premieres globally as a ten-episode binge on Wednesday, July 9, exclusively on Prime Video.
The cast includes Courtney Taylor (Abbott Elementary), John Carroll Lynch (American Horror Story), Michael Mosley (The Calling), Rebecca Field (All Rise), Victoria Moroles (Never Have I Ever), Amy Hill (Magnum P.I.), Ricardo Chavira (Desperate Housewives), Noah Bean (Nikita), Alain Uy (Power Book IV: Force), and Hector Hugo (Snowfall).
Ballard is executive produced by Michael Connelly, Henrik Bastin, Michael Alaimo, Kendall Sherwood, and Trish Hofmann. Jasmine Russ serves as co-executive producer under Fabel Entertainment. Jamie Boscardin Martin and Trey Batchelor also serve as co-executive producers. Theresa Snider serves as co-executive producer for Hieronymus Pictures.
